How JPG to KEY Conversion Works

JPEG Image (JPG) uses lossy DCT compression that permanently discards fine pixel detail to achieve small file sizes, ideal for photographs. KEY file (KEY) stores data in the KEY format. This embeds the raster image inside a document container, fixing its dimensions on the page. Metadata such as creation date is preserved where the target format supports it; features the target format cannot represent are dropped. JPG is a lossy raster format (no transparency), while KEY is a different container/format used by KEY-supported software. The conversion repackages the image data, and any additional compression depends on the KEY settings.
It should look similar, but because JPG is already lossy and KEY may apply its own compression or color handling, there can be minor quality shifts. Using higher quality output settings helps minimize artifacts.
No—JPG does not store an alpha channel, so transparency cannot be created during the conversion. If you need transparency, start from a source format that includes alpha.
KEY support depends on the software or device that reads KEY. After conversion, test by opening the .key file in your target application to confirm compatibility.
